Basement Plumbing Installation in Denver, CO
Basement plumbing installation services encompass the setup of essential water supply and drainage systems within a home's lower level. This includes installing new pipes for sinks, toilets, laundry areas, and other fixtures, as well as ensuring proper connections to the main water line and sewer system. These projects are common during basement remodels, additions, or when upgrading outdated plumbing to improve functionality and prevent future issues. Homeowners typically want to understand the scope of work involved, the materials used, and how the installation will impact their existing plumbing infrastructure.
Before requesting basement plumbing installation, property owners should consider the layout of their space, any existing plumbing systems, and specific fixture needs. It is important to clarify whether the project involves new construction or modifications to existing plumbing, and to understand any local building codes or regulations that may apply. Proper planning ensures the installation aligns with the property’s requirements and helps prevent potential disruptions or costly adjustments later on.

Common Basement Plumbing Installation Jobs
Basement plumbing rough-ins - installing essential water supply and drain lines before finishing a basement.
Sump pump installation - setting up drainage systems to prevent basement flooding and water damage.
Fixture hookups - connecting sinks, toilets, and laundry appliances to existing plumbing systems.
Leak repairs - fixing hidden or visible leaks to protect basement structures and prevent water issues.
Drain line installation - setting up proper drainage for basement bathrooms and laundry areas.
Water heater setup - installing or replacing water heaters to ensure reliable hot water supply.
Basement Plumbing Installation Questions
What types of basement plumbing installations are commonly requested? Typical projects include new drain lines, sump pumps, laundry hookups, and utility sink installations to support basement use.
Is it necessary to upgrade existing plumbing during basement renovations? Upgrading or rerouting plumbing may be recommended to accommodate new layouts or prevent future issues.
What should property owners consider before installing a new basement sump pump? It’s important to evaluate the basement’s water drainage needs and choose a pump suitable for the space and water flow.
How can property owners ensure proper drainage in a basement plumbing system? Proper slope, venting, and quality piping are essential for effective drainage and preventing backups or leaks.
